FIRST's statement on Einstein

Just saw this got posted on Tumblr:

Quote:
Dear FRC Teams:

Thank you for your incredible enthusiasm and Gracious Professionalism throughout the year and at the Championship.

We apologize for the technical problems that affected the final matches at our Championship. We will examine all of the facts, report our findings and ultimately solve any and all identified issues.

Sincerely,

Jon Dudas

President, FIRST

I couldn't have said it any better. The most disappointing thing about these random field issues is that FIRST has been seeing them and denying them all season long.

At one regional, they made a point to blame the multiple teams with random disconnects in the eliminations when the crowd began to react, even though the evidence was by no means conclusive.

It's absolutely horrible that the issues happened on Einstein field, in a way that was both obvious and large scale. I am glad FIRST is finally recognizing there is a problem, but they had weeks to years of observations that they were denying before this. It's a shame. At least the issues are finally getting the attention they need.
